Your local police can assist you. By California law it is illegal to have any airsoft guns other than ones that are clear or neon colored out in public. Over in Pleasanton it is illegal to shoot an airsoft gun (or any type of gun that shoots any type of projectile for that matter). In Dublin, minors are not allowed to posses or discharge airsoft guns unless given permission from their parents, but no one is allowed to have or shoot an airsoft gun in a public park. Otherwise ownership should be legal (consult your local law enforcement for a correct and current answer, I cannot be held responsible if anyone breaks the law because of this answer)

look on the box for the fps anything over 330 is strong for a rifle. but handguns are good anything over 250fps.This above information is fine for an Airsoft gun but for a non airsoft BB gun the FPS is different. A BB gun that shoots 460 FPS is considered strong and a BB rifle that shoots 600 FPS is considered strong. A pellet rifle that shoots a .177 caliber pellet at 1200 FPS is considered strong. Pellet guns and pellet Rifle are capable of producing faster speeds and more impact than BB guns and Rifles. Like Airsoft the FPS will be on the box or on the web page.The only way to tell is to get a chronographer and shoot at lest 10 shots through it and get the numbers, high, low, and the average. Now you'll have a better idea of how powerful the gun is. Speculation isn't very scientific, or accurate.
